#eb1d2e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#eb1d2e is composed of 92.2% red, 11.4% green and 18%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 87.7% magenta, 80.4%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 355 degrees, a saturation of 83.7% and a lightness of 51.8%. #eb1d2e color hex could be obtained by blending #ff3a5c with #d70000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3333.

#eb1d2e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#eb1d2e has RGB values of R:235, G:29, B:46 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.88, Y:0.8, K:0.08. Its decimal value is 15408430.

Shades and Tints of #eb1d2e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080101 is the darkest color, while #fef5f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#eb1d2e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8c7c7d is the less saturated color, while #fe0a1e is the most saturated one.
